It's hard to believe, but another year is over! Although it's very sad that another year is done, Miss Katie & Miss Jen are so proud of how much all of the Intensely Irish dancers have grown over the past year! And we went out with a bang at In.Motion's year end show earlier this month. The theme of this year's show was a re-telling of the children's book "Giraffe's Can't Dance". For the first time in our studio's history, the show was held at Centre in the Square! Our junior and senior dancers combined forces to perform an impressive hardshoe routine where our feet represented thunder and we used bright silver sticks to represent lighting. Our senior dancers impressed with their intricate footwork while our junior dancers (for many of whom it was their first time on stage) brought tons of energy to the routine. Our juniors and seniors combined forces once again to perform an exciting softshoe routine representing the moment at which Gerald the Giraffe realizes he can dance! This routine allowed our dancers to work together as a team and also showcase some of the difficult moves they've been working on all year. In the end, both of the routines looked phenomenal and the audience loved them! Needless to say, although it is sad another year is over, Miss Katie & Miss Jen are incredibly proud of all the things their dancers have accomplished this year and how well they performed at our year end show! But don't count us out just yet - we still have a busy summer ahead of us with a couple of performances and our 3rd annual summer class. Plus, there is always next year to look forward to!
